Shirodhara - How to Prepare

Developed in India thousands of years ago, shirodhara originally was a part of

a sacred internal and external detoxification and healing ritual called pancha karma

that was reserved exclusively for the royalty in India. Today, shirodhara is used

separately as a deep rejuvenation treatment usually only available at very high-end,

luxury spas.

 

It is a beautiful, powerful, ancient therapy that works on the body, mind and spirit.

 

As such, there are a few things you need to do to prepare yourself for it:

 

 

1) Before you come

 

  • no heavy eating

  • no full stomach

  • no alcohol

 

If you have a full stomach or have had any alcohol before the treatment,

we cannot do the treatment.

It will be harmful rather than beneficial.

 

 

2) Bring with you

 

- an old hat or scarf or bandana or head covering

 

You will be given a turban for your hair, but you may want to have something covering the turban for your way home.

 

 

3) Phones must be on airplane mode for the entire session

 

Please make whatever arrangements are necessary for you to be able to put your phone on airplane mode for the entire session.

 

 

4) Only plan light activity for the rest of the day. Even better: no activity

 

It is recommended that you have only light activities planned after this treatment. Even better would be to have nothing planned for the rest of the day. It’s a powerful treatment, but its benefits can be undone if you immediately force yourself back into any stressful or demanding activity or social interaction afterwards.

 

5) Allow yourself the time to go at your own pace after the treatment

 

When planning your schedule, allow for yourself to be able to take extra time before you get back in your car or drive home. Allow yourself NOT to be in a rush after the treatment. Give yourself this space to have the time to enjoy the experience fully.

 

6) If you wear contact lenses, you will be asked to take them out

 

Although every effort is made to avoid this, it is possible that some of the oil will get in your eyes. If you have contact lenses in, this could become uncomfortable.

 

There is no concern about the oil getting in the eyes except for the possible discomfort of contact lenses. There is an Ayurvedic eye healing treatment where this same oil is directly administered to the eyes.
